The scientific research study is about financial methodology analysis improving in the framework of forensic economic examination. The objective bankruptcy date is one of the issues within the forensic examination. The authors propose to supplement the classical financial analysis with a special section, which analyzes transactions for compliance with market conditions, identifies schematic and fictitious transactions, and also determines the degree of their impact on the occurrence of property insufficiency and signs of bankruptcy. The author's classification of possible schematic transactions, as well as methods for establishing the fact of compliance with the market situation are proposed. As the criterion for the maximum permissible deviations of transaction values from market values, it is proposed to use a value in an amount not exceeding the change in values by more than two times. The technical assets identified as a result of fictitious transactions are proposed to be deducted from the market value of assets when calculating the net assets of the organization, which will allow the most correct determination of the objective bankruptcy date.

AbstractIn accordance with generally accepted accounting standards, most intangibles are not accounted for and not reflected in the traditional financial accounting. For this reason, most companies account intangible assets (IAs) as expenses. In the research, 57 sub-elements of IAs were applied, which are grouped into eight main elements of IAs. The classification of IAs consists in two parts of assets: accounting and non-accounting. This classification can be successfully applied in different branches of enterprises, to expand and supplement the theoretical and practical concepts of the company's financial management. The article proposes to evaluate not only the value of financial information for IAs (accounted) but also the value of non-financial information for IAs (non-accounted), thus revealing the true value of IAs that is available to the companies of Lithuania. It names a value of general IAs. The results of the research confirmed the IA valuation methodology, which allows companies to calculate the fair value of an IA. The obtained extended IAs valuation information may be valuable to both the owners of the company and investors, as this value plays an important practical role in assessing the impact of IAs on the market value of companies.

Aqueous extracts from 30 species of red algae were treated with κ-carrageenase, a specific hydrolase for κ-carrageenin. The total reducing power of the hydrolyzate indicated that the algae could be divided into three groups on the basis of the content of κ-carrageenin. Group 1 included Gigartina acicularis, G. radula, G. pistillata, G. christata, and Iridaea sp. with a low value. Group 2 included Chondrus crispus, G. stellata, G. stiriata, Rhodoglossum affine, Furcellaria fastigiata, and Endocladia muricata, all with values comparable with that in C. crispus. Group 3 included Hypnea musciformis and a Yatabella sp. with a value greater than that for C. crispus. The occurrence of agarose and of κ-carrageenin in the Rhodophyceae is discussed as a factor in their taxonomy.

Grouping of tomato maturity level is one way to pay attention to the quality of the tomatoes. The traditional way takes a long time and low accuracy, since the determination of the level of subjectively assessed. In addition, the importance of the classification of the level of maturity of tomatoes due to a period of tomato maturation process is relatively quick, so it can reduce the risk of rotting tomatoes. The dataset used in this study was 108 tomato image taken using three types of smartphones. The dataset is divided into 66 training data and testing the data 42. Improvements to the image preprocessing stage is done with adaptive histogram equalization and compared with the histogram equalization. In the feature extraction using color features of the R, G, and A *. The classification of the level of maturity of tomato is done by comparing the accuracy of using multi-SVM and KNN. In the Multi-SVM method using the highest percentage of kernel functions RBG is equal to 77.84%. While the method kNN highest percentage was 77.79% using a value of k = 3.

Hydrosedimentological studies are fundamental for the adequate management of water resources. The Jordão River, the research study area, has the potential to generate electricity to serve a region of the TriânguloMineiro and Alto Paranaíba. In this sense, the understanding of sediment transport resources is important, since it represents a fundamental contribution for ensuring adequate management of water resources in the region. This research study has the general objective of examining sediment transport in the Jordão River, with the aim of obtaining a preliminary understanding into the dynamics of solid particles in this water body. To this end, the determination of the key curves of Flow vs Sediment concentration, the characterization of the sediment granulometry and the hydraulic and geometric aspects of the studied stations, as well as the analysis of the factors that influence the dynamics of sediments in the river, will be carried out. For this purpose, four sampling stations were established, fourteen campaigns were carried out for flow measurements and water and sediment collections for the analysis of suspended and bed sediments in dry and rainy seasons from August 2017 to December 2018. A relationship between suspended sediment concentration and liquid discharge is found in the literature as Css = α·Qβ, at the four stations on the Jordan River during the measured period, with a value of 14.593 <α <26.904 and 0.6722 <β <0.9462, along with the graph representing all values Css = 22.944·Q0.6991. Noteworthy from the collections carried out is the relationship between rainy and dry seasons, where there is no increase verified in the filming of sediments with the increase in the flow of the river. Regarding the bed solids obtained through granulometric curves, there is a noted deposit of sediments with less granulometry in the dry season, mainly in seasons 3 and 4.

Humans need vitamin A and obtain essential vitamin A by conversion of plant foods rich in provitamin A and/or absorption of preformed vitamin A from foods of animal origin. The determination of the vitamin A value of plant foods rich in provitamin A is important but has challenges. The aim of this paper is to review the progress over last 80 years following the discovery on the conversion of β-carotene to vitamin A and the various techniques including stable isotope technologies that have been developed to determine vitamin A values of plant provitamin A (mainly β-carotene). These include applications from using radioactive β-carotene and vitamin A, depletion-repletion with vitamin A and β-carotene, and measuring postprandial chylomicron fractions after feeding a β-carotene rich diet, to using stable isotopes as tracers to follow the absorption and conversion of plant food provitamin A carotenoids (mainly β-carotene) in humans. These approaches have greatly promoted our understanding of the absorption and conversion of β-carotene to vitamin A. Stable isotope labeled plant foods are useful for determining the overall bioavailability of provitamin A carotenoids from specific foods. Locally obtained plant foods can provide vitamin A and prevent deficiency of vitamin A, a remaining worldwide concern.

The formation of business strategies of enterprises should be based on a preliminary assessment of their current and future economic opportunities. Such an assessment is to establish the value of the total economic potential of enterprises and its individual varieties. The purpose of this study was to clarify the essence of the economic potential of enterprises, justify the need for its evaluation and selection of its types. The main approaches to interpreting the terms "potential" and "enterprise potential" are identified. These include resource, result, resource-result, resource-target, and result-target concepts. It is established that the potential of any object, including the enterprise, can be interpreted as a set of its external functional properties, which this object shows or can show in a certain state of the environment in which it is located. Accordingly, the assessment of the potential of an object should be based on the identification and determination of its external properties, taking into account the environment in which the object is located. The main situations in which there is a need for information about certain components of the economic potential of the enterprise are identified, and the types of this potential and the consumers of the information about their level, corresponding to these situations, are determined. In particular, such situations include management of production and sales, management of financial and economic results of the enterprise, management of enterprise development, assessment of the company's need for various types of resources, assessment of enterprise value, assessment of current and future impact of the enterprise on the economy of the country (region), etc. The features of classification of types of enterprise potential existing in the scientific literature are supplemented by the following ones: by the main types of economic activity, by the dynamics of changes in the economic and production system of the enterprise, by consequences for the subject of enterprise potential assessment, by the stages of economic activity, enterprise potential, etc. The obtained results make it possible to improve the understanding of the complex patterns that underlie the formation of the economic potential of enterprises.

The concept of failed state came to the fore with the end of the Cold War, the collapse of the USSR and the disintegration of Yugoslavia. Political violence is central in these discussions on the definition of the concept or the determination of its dimensions (indicators). Specifically, the level of political violence, the type of political violence and intensity of political violence has been broached in the literature. An effective classification of political violence can lead us to a better understanding of state failure phenomenon. By using Tilly’s classification of collective violence which is based on extent of coordination among violent actors and salience of short-run damage, the role played by political violence in state failure can be understood clearly. In order to do this, two recent cases, Iraq and Syria will be examined.

There are many cases of email abuse that have the potential to harm others. This email abuse is commonly known as spam, which contains advertisements, phishing scams, and even malware. This study purpose to know the classification of email spam with ham using the KNN method as an effort to reduce the amount of spam. KNN can classify spam or ham in an email by checking it using a different K value approach. The results of the classification evaluation using confusion matrix resulted in the KNN method with a value of K = 1 having the highest accuracy value of 91.4%. From the results of the study, it is known that the optimization of the K value in KNN using frequency distribution clustering can produce high accuracy of 100%, while k-means clustering produces an accuracy of 99%. So based on the results of the existing accuracy values, the frequency distribution clustering and k-means clustering can be used to optimize the K-optimal value of the KNN in the classification of existing spam emails.
